Ptosis surgery in Houston is a specialized procedure aimed at correcting drooping eyelids, a condition medically known as ptosis. This condition can occur due to aging, injury, or congenital factors, and it can significantly affect a person's vision and appearance. In Houston, this surgery is performed by skilled ophthalmic plastic surgeons who are experts in reconstructive and cosmetic eyelid surgery.
The surgery involves tightening or repositioning the levator muscle, which lifts the eyelid. Depending on the severity and cause of the ptosis, the surgeon may use different techniques, such as shortening the levator muscle or attaching it to the eyelid margin. The goal is to restore the eyelid to its normal position, improving both the aesthetic appearance and the functional vision.
Ptosis surgery in Houston is typically performed on an outpatient basis, meaning patients can return home the same day. The procedure is relatively quick, often taking less than an hour, and recovery is generally straightforward with minimal discomfort. Patients may experience some swelling and bruising, but these side effects usually resolve within a week or two.
